Job Description:
Kickstart your legal career with Brookfield Properties' expert legal services team.
We are seeking a highly motivated individual to join our high-performing team of lawyers where our ambition is to grow our talent from within.
As paralegal, you'll play a critical role in ensuring our work is executed and managed to a high standard while receiving important on-the-job mentoring and training to ensure you have the right tools and skills to further your legal career.
You'll be joining a team of intelligent, fun and caring lawyers - each at different stages in their careers - who together provide a suite of strategic services for our real estate operations in Australia across the gamut of property law, supporting a growing sphere of real estate assets and classes.
This position will suit a critical thinking, self-starting and enthusiastic paralegal who wants to build their career in property law.
You may currently be studying or already have experience as a paralegal and want to shift you career into a top tier organisation.
Responsible for:
- Manage and oversee document execution and filing processes, including obtaining mortgagee consents
- Assist with managing and updating precedent documentation
- Liaising with Legal and Treasury teams to ensure up to date information on lenders and mortgagee consent requirements
- Manage PPSR registrations
- Maintaining databases and key document summaries
- Assist with managing engagement of external legal service providers and processing of legal invoices
- Assist SVP Legal Counsel with tracking budgets and processing of monthly expenses
- Assist with updating policies and procedures
- Work with BPA Legal and Risk to implement processes
- Assist in maintaining records and auditing of professional certifications, including team practising certificates and real estate licences
- Assist with due diligence and obtaining property and company related searches using online databases and tools
- Provide administrative and secretarial support to the Brookfield Properties Australia legal team
- Organise travel, itineraries and associated bookings for the team
- Organise meetings, workshops, conferences and events
- Maintain subscriptions and workeflow databases
- Maintain and update Legal intranet page
- Assist and work with other Executive Assistants, Administrators and support functions where needed.
- Foster positive and strategic relationships with internal and external stakeholders
- Completing work in a timely and accurate manner
- Develop an understanding of the business and its culture
- Maintain strict confidentiality in relation to matters
